What you can expect

  • Take a day off as an individual tourist and enjoy the beauty of the Beara Peninsula in a small group of up to 6 people in a comfortable minibus in a relaxed atmosphere.
    This tour takes you to ancient stone circles, impressive megaliths, and other prehistoric sites deeply rooted in the history of this landscape and all of Ireland.
    Along the way, you will experience the spectacular coastal and mountain landscape of the Beara Peninsula with its dramatic views over the Atlantic – a paradise for photography and relaxed exploration.
    The tour is suitable for history buffs, curious travellers, and families alike, and combines the wild nature of Ireland with the mysterious world of its prehistoric monuments – at a relaxed, personal pace.
    As a trained regional tour guide/Irish Heritage and Culture and with 30 years of experience in West Cork, it is important to me to show guests an authentic Ireland. I combine the latest archaeological findings with the sites, making Ireland's rich cultural heritage tangible and palpable.
    The tour departs from Skibbereen at 9:00 AM, with the option to join in Bantry or Glengarriff (Kenmare on request). It goes across the Beara Peninsula and ends back in Bantry at 5:30 PM or 6:00 PM in Skibbereen.
    The price includes entry fees/donations as well as snacks.
    We will have lunch in a small, charming restaurant near a mountain lake, in the middle of the rugged nature of Beara.
    In the afternoon, we will stop for refreshments in the most beautiful, colourful little village in Ireland. From there, you can sit back and relax, letting the impressions sink in and enjoying the scenery as we drive home along Bantry Bay.
